About Rotring
rOtring was founded in Hamburg in 1928 as Tintenkuli Handels GmbH and is best known for technical drawing instruments, particularly the Rapidograph and Isograph pens and the 600/800 mechanical pencils. Its fountain pens follow the same functional, matte-black-and-red-ring industrial aesthetic; the ArtPen calligraphy and sketch line and the hexagonal metal 600 are the best-known examples. The company was acquired by Sanford (Newell Brands) in 1998 and its fountain pen offering is now limited and modestly priced.
How to fill the Rotring Tintenkuli
Fill it two ways: snap in a pre-filled international cartridge for convenience, or use a converter — a small plunger or twist mechanism that installs the same way a cartridge does — to draw ink from any bottle. The converter route opens up the entire world of bottled ink, which is where most of the hobby's color variety lives.
Choosing a nib size
Nib size determines line width, not writing pressure — fountain pens are meant to glide, never press. Extra-fine (EF) suits small, dense handwriting and thin paper; fine (F) is the most broadly recommended default; medium (M) shows more ink character and shading; broad (B) and stub grinds favor bold, expressive strokes and calligraphy-adjacent writing.
Keeping it clean
A quick flush with cool water every time you switch ink colors — and a full clean every 4–6 weeks of regular use — is enough to keep the nib and feed performing well. Inktend's cleaning reminder is tuned to a 21-day baseline and adjusts naturally to how often you actually refill.
